Factors to Consider When Choosing Ergonomic Study Desks For Students

Choosing the right ergonomic study desk for students involves balancing adjustability, size, storage, and stability. The ideal desk supports proper posture, reduces fatigue, and fits comfortably into the available space. Whether you prioritize height flexibility, storage options, or a sleek design, understanding key features helps in making an informed decision.

Adjustability and Ergonomics

Look for desks with adjustable height to accommodate different student sizes and postures. Height-adjustable desks promote better ergonomics, especially when students switch between sitting and standing. Consider motorized options for effortless adjustments, or manual ones if you prefer simplicity and lower cost.

Size and Space

Measure your available space carefully. Larger desks with extensive surface areas and multiple storage compartments suit students with lots of materials or tech gear, but they can overwhelm small rooms. Compact options may sacrifice some storage but keep the room feeling open and uncluttered.

Material and Durability

Materials like laminate and solid wood tend to last longer and are easier to clean, which benefits students who study daily. Particle board, while more affordable, may wear faster over time. Choose a material that aligns with your budget and durability needs.

Assembly and Budget

Consider how much time and effort you’re willing to invest in assembly. Some desks come pre-assembled or require minimal setup, while others might need more time and tools. Match your budget with the features you need—more adjustable and larger desks generally cost more.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why is adjustable height important for a student desk?

Adjustable height allows students to customize their workspace to their body size and posture preferences. This flexibility helps prevent discomfort and promotes better ergonomics, especially during long study sessions or when switching between sitting and standing positions.

What size should I consider for a student desk?

The ideal size depends on available space and the student’s materials. A typical workspace should comfortably fit a laptop, books, and writing space. Larger desks offer more room but can be overwhelming in small rooms, so measure carefully before choosing.

Are motorized standing desks worth the investment?

For students who frequently change positions or want to improve posture, motorized desks provide effortless height adjustments, making ergonomic transitions easier. However, they tend to cost more and may require more maintenance than manual options.

What materials are best for durability?

Laminate and solid wood surfaces generally stand up better to daily wear and tear compared to particle board. If durability is a priority, investing in a desk with these materials can extend the lifespan of the workspace.

How important is storage in a student desk?

Storage features like drawers, shelves, or hutch units help keep materials organized and reduce clutter. For students with many supplies or tech gadgets, ample storage can enhance focus and create a cleaner workspace.
